summaryrefslogtreecommitdiffstats
path: root/winit
diff options
context:
space:
mode:
Diffstat (limited to '')
-rw-r--r--winit/src/application.rs2
-rw-r--r--winit/src/conversion.rs8
-rw-r--r--winit/src/system.rs2
3 files changed, 6 insertions, 6 deletions
diff --git a/winit/src/application.rs b/winit/src/application.rs
index 9c7dd74e..99402cf5 100644
--- a/winit/src/application.rs
+++ b/winit/src/application.rs
@@ -647,7 +647,7 @@ mod platform {
{
use winit::platform::run_return::EventLoopExtRunReturn;
- let _ = event_loop.run_return(event_handler);
+ event_loop.run_return(event_handler);
Ok(())
}
diff --git a/winit/src/conversion.rs b/winit/src/conversion.rs
index 8e6c0b37..74f6f7a0 100644
--- a/winit/src/conversion.rs
+++ b/winit/src/conversion.rs
@@ -485,10 +485,10 @@ pub fn key_code(
// As defined in: http://www.unicode.org/faq/private_use.html
pub(crate) fn is_private_use_character(c: char) -> bool {
- match c {
+ matches!(
+ c,
'\u{E000}'..='\u{F8FF}'
| '\u{F0000}'..='\u{FFFFD}'
- | '\u{100000}'..='\u{10FFFD}' => true,
- _ => false,
- }
+ | '\u{100000}'..='\u{10FFFD}'
+ )
}
diff --git a/winit/src/system.rs b/winit/src/system.rs
index 0ed61dc9..0303707e 100644
--- a/winit/src/system.rs
+++ b/winit/src/system.rs
@@ -24,7 +24,7 @@ pub(crate) fn information(
let memory_used = sysinfo::get_current_pid()
.and_then(|pid| system.process(pid).ok_or("Process not found"))
- .and_then(|process| Ok(process.memory()))
+ .map(|process| process.memory())
.ok();
Information {